Address: Haines City, FL 33844, USA
“This 300 acre preserve is one of the many Southwest Water Management District Lands. It is a beautiful example of Central Florida's unique ecosystems, from scrubs to cypress swamps. This property is divided into two sections. The northern property is about 6 miles by road (see website listed for directions and map). The entrance is off Horseshoe Creek Road. There is no water or restrooms but there is a nice parking area and kiosk at both. Note: The site is called different names by the different management partners. The sign at the North entrance says, Lake Marion Creek Management Area, Horse Creek. The preserve is on the border of the South Florida Water Management District to the East and the South West Water Management District on the West. The Recreation Guide of the Southwest Management District Lands calls the site, Lake Marion Creek Horseshoe Scrub Tract. The Florida Fish and Wildlife Commission is also part of the Cooperative and there is a sign here by them that says Lake Marion Creek Wildlife Management Area. If that isn't confusing enough it is also managed with the Polk County Board of Commissioners.”

Address: 3315 US-25, Dry Ridge, KY 41035, USA
“** This is the same place as Cincinnati south, not sure why 2 listings so I will copy my review for the same place just a slightly different name** This is a great little campground. I love the fact it is a true campground not a place full of people living here year round. The grounds are kept very nice and tidy. The pond is a nice place to go for a walk with the dogs and cast a fishing rod. There is a small dated playground but at least it is somewhere for the kids to play. The desk person was extremely nice as was the person who escorted us to the campsite. The sites are fairly level and rain drainage is great considering it has been raining for days there are no puddles to deal with. The laundry room was clean and had 5 washers and very fast drying vintage dryers. The bathhouse was extremely clean and in good working order. The key elements to a campground were met: clean, safe, level, good power, good water pressure, clean laundry room, clean bathhouse and a VERY reasonable price for water/electric. Now the downside is the train. It is about 50 yards from our site (we were 1 of the closest sites). However, we use the fan all night and keep the windows closed, so it drowns out the noise. But if you are a light sleeper or in a pop up/canvas sided camper you may have issues. The highway is close as well so you do hear the highway but only when outside walking around. For us that is a non issue. It is easy on and off the highway and gas stations nearby which makes it a great stop over place for a few days to visit the area and the Ark. We will definitely stay again if we are in the area.”
